Designed by renowned British naval architect Uffa Fox, this classic 14-foot centerboard dinghy represents excellent small boat craftsmanship from the golden age of recreational sailing. Built by Bell Woodworking in the UK between 1959 and 1971, with 250 hulls produced during its production run, the Pegasus 14 showcases Fox's talent for creating seaworthy yet spirited small craft. The plywood and fiberglass construction delivers durability while keeping displacement to a modest 200 pounds, making the boat easily manageable for launching and retrieval. Its fractional sloop rig carries 137 square feet of sail area, providing spirited performance with a theoretical hull speed of 5.01 knots. The relatively high sail area-to-displacement ratio of 64.14 indicates this dinghy has excellent light-air performance and responds well to crew weight positioning. With a beam of 4.83 feet and draft of 4.25 feet, the Pegasus 14 offers good stability for its size while the centerboard configuration allows shallow water exploration. The low comfort ratio of 2.68 confirms this is purely a day sailor, ideal for protected waters, sailing instruction, or recreational sailing in harbors and coastal areas. This classic dinghy suits sailors seeking traditional handling characteristics in a proven design.

What is the Pegasus 14's sail area to displacement ratio?
The Pegasus 14 has a Sail Area to Displacement ratio (SA/D) of 64.14. Values between 14–18 are typical cruising sailboats; 18–22 is cruiser/racer; over 22 is performance racing.
What is the Pegasus 14's comfort ratio?
The Pegasus 14 has a Ted Brewer Comfort Ratio of 2.68. A ratio over 30 indicates good offshore comfort; over 40 is very comfortable offshore.
Is the Pegasus 14 safe for offshore sailing?
The Pegasus 14 has a Capsize Screening Formula value of 3.3. Values under 2.0 are considered acceptable for offshore sailing; under 1.8 is ideal.
What is the hull speed of the Pegasus 14?
The theoretical hull speed of the Pegasus 14 is 5.01 kn knots, calculated from its waterline length.
How much does a Pegasus 14 weigh?
The Pegasus 14 has a displacement of 200.00 lb and a length overall (LOA) of 14.50 ft.
Who designed the Pegasus 14?
The Pegasus 14 was designed by Uffa Fox, first built in 1959.
